Which patents cover Xtrelus, and what generic alternatives are available?
Xtrelus is a drug marketed by Eci Pharms Llc and is included in one NDA.
The generic ingredient in XTRELUS is guaifenesin; hydrocodone bitartrate. There are twenty drug master file entries for this compound. Additional details are available on the guaifenesin; hydrocodone bitartrate profile page.
